Output 80043b4df8d7d55b21c35095708f3706b2adcd5908322395782eccbeeefe18e0:7

value
84586159342
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64381287bb244a13ce2ff1e36787cab89cdb5308 OP_EQUALVERIFY OP_CHECKSIG
address
LUMs1NcwH2hMtZtohfC1VF241Y1oQTYS9V
transaction
80043b4df8d7d55b21c35095708f3706b2adcd5908322395782eccbeeefe18e0
spent
true